Что такое API и как действует взаимодействие сервисов
API представляет собой набор стандартов, которые позволяют приложениям обмениваться информацией между собой. Аббревиатура трактуется как Application Programming Interface, что интерпретируется как программный интерфейс приложения. Технология является промежуточным между софтверными частями.
Связь служб через Покердом реализуется по модели требования и отклика. Одна система отправляет требование, а другая интерпретирует сведения и возвращает результат. Процесс схож разговор, только сторонами выступают программные приложения.
Нынешние цифровые продукты непрерывно делятся сведениями для исполнения операций клиентов. Софтверный интерфейс превращает такой взаимодействие единообразным и прогнозируемым.
Технология устраняет вопрос согласованности различных сред. Инженеры создают решения на различных языках программирования, но благодаря Pokerdom эти платформы успешно взаимодействуют независимо от собственной устройства.
Понятие API и его роль в нынешних технологиях
Программный механизм приложения действует как протокол между софтверными платформами. Договор регламентирует формат обращений, конфигурацию данных и правила получения результатов. Программисты используют описание для изучения имеющихся инструментов.
Технология выполняет важнейшую роль в цифровой архитектуре. Финансовые решения, социальные платформы и платёжные решения взаимодействуют через Покердом официальный сайт для создания комплексных решений. Без такого обмена любому приложению пришлось бы строить функции отдельно.
Механизмы обеспечивают предприятиям наращивать функции систем без роста персонала. Фирма может встроить готовые инструменты для платежей или позиционирования вместо разработки этих данных. Подход экономит время и средства.
Современная экономика сервисов построена на переиспользовании функций. Софтверный механизм гарантирует стандартизированный подключение к функциям системы и ускоряет формирование цифровых продуктов.
Схема коммуникации сведениями между приложениями
Коммуникация данными между приложениями осуществляется через форматированные запросы. Пользовательское решение формирует требование с параметрами и направляет его серверу. Сервер обрабатывает данные, производит процедуры и посылает результат назад.
Сведения пересылаются в нормализованных структурах, чаще всего JSON или XML. Шаблоны предоставляют единообразие конфигурации и упрощают анализ отличающимися приложениями. Клиент и узел воспринимают конфигурацию благодаря установленным правилам.
Всякий требование несёт вид манипуляции, местоположение элемента и настройки действия. Типы указывают тип процедуры: извлечение информации, формирование записи, изменение или удаление объекта. Софтверный механизм через Покердом обрабатывает запросы согласно указанным методам.
Отклик системы включает идентификатор статуса и сведения ответа. Шифр информирует об успешности действия или неполадках. Информация имеют запрошенную информацию в согласованном структуре. Механизм работает независимо от системы решений.
Образцы API в ежедневной практике пользователей
Программные интерфейсы сопровождают юзеров в повседневных компьютерных действиях. Многие привычные действия функционируют благодаря обмену сведениями между сервисами. Технология продолжает незаметной, но даёт комфорт эксплуатации решений.
Популярные примеры применения интерфейсов в будничной практике:
- Аутентификация через социальные сети задействует инструменты Facebook или Google для проверки персоны
- Интегрированные карты в системах такси извлекают данные о трассах через Pokerdom географических решений
- Онлайн-оплата покупок действует через инструменты платёжных решений, проводящих платежи
- Предвидение климата скачивается с метеорологических систем через целевые средства
- Распространение фотографий в несколько социальных ресурсов происходит через программные механизмы конкретной платформы
Клиенты работают с сотнями механизмов постоянно, не догадываясь об этом. Технология создаёт цифровой взаимодействие плавным и удобным.
Как API облегчает объединение разных систем
Подключение без софтверных механизмов потребовала бы изучения собственной архитектуры любой платформы. Инженерам пришлось бы разбираться структуру репозиториев информации и механизмы интерпретации партнёрского продукта. Такой путь требовал бы периоды и формировал риски сохранности.
Софтверный механизм выдаёт сформированный набор возможностей для связи. Разработчик изучает спецификацию и приступает эксплуатировать опции внешнего системы через Покердом официальный сайт за несколько суток. Собственное организация системы сохраняется невидимым и изолированным.
Нормализация видов передачи ликвидирует необходимость формирования особых продуктов для любого участника. Компания строит общий средство, который эксплуатируют множество клиентов. Подход снижает расходы на поддержку подключений.
Блочная структура предоставляет менять элементы без переписывания приложения. Организация может изменить партнёра финансовых операций, подключив свежий средство. Адаптивность форсирует настройку бизнеса к трансформациям сектора.
Запросы и реакции: базовая механика выполнения API
Логика коммуникации строится на цикле запрос-ответ между клиентом и узлом. Пользовательское программа инициирует коммуникацию, посылая требование с указанием требуемого манипуляции. Узел анализирует требование и составляет реакцию с исходом манипуляции.
Обращение включает множество обязательных элементов. Способ устанавливает тип манипуляции: получение, генерацию, обновление или стирание данных. Местоположение обозначает заданный компонент на сервере. Заголовки имеют служебную о формате и настройках проверки. Контент обращения отправляет сведения для обработки.
Отклик сервера состоит из идентификатора статуса и данных исхода. Идентификаторы информируют об результативности или типе ошибки. Удачные процедуры выдают номера диапазона 200, ошибки приложения — серии 400, проблемы хоста — диапазона 500. Софтверный интерфейс через poker dom предоставляет понятную связь между приложениями.
Данные реакции имеют желаемую информацию в форматированном структуре. Система парсит извлечённые информацию и использует их для показа пользователю или дальнейшей анализа.
Конфиденциальность и проверка при использовании API
Охрана данных при коммуникации между системами потребует многоуровневых средств охраны. Софтверные интерфейсы транслируют приватную информацию, содержащие личные информацию пользователей. Отсутствие охраны генерирует угрозы разглашения и неразрешённого проникновения.
Идентификация устанавливает персону клиента перед открытием входа к компонентам. Решения задействуют токены доступа или ключи для верификации обращающейся стороны. Маркер посылается с любым запросом и подтверждает возможность на выполнение процедуры через Pokerdom зашифрованного подключения.
Кодирование сведений охраняет информацию при транспортировке по сети. Стандарт HTTPS гарантирует закодированное связь между приложением и системой. Перехват трафика не обеспечивает расшифровать контент требований и реакций.
Лимитирование количества обращений предупреждает нарушения и избыточность серверов. Платформы задают пороги на численность требований за интервал. Переход порога прекращает соединение или требует дополнительной идентификации.
Открытые и внутренние API: различия и применение
Софтверные средства распределяются на открытые и внутренние в зависимости от намеченной группы. Публичные инструменты предоставлены для независимых инженеров. Внутренние задействуются в компании для взаимодействия собственных систем.
Публичные интерфейсы обеспечивают вход к возможностям широкому диапазону пользователей. Предприятия выпускают документацию и распределяют коды подключения. Схема расширяет инфраструктуру решения через Покердом доступных опций объединения.
Ключевые различия между категориями интерфейсов:
- Открытые запрашивают развёрнутой документации и технической поддержки для независимых разработчиков
- Внутренние эксплуатируются собственными коллективами и содержат базовую документацию
- Общедоступные проходят строгий аудит сохранности из-за общедоступного доступа
- Частные предоставляют обмен компонентов в внутренней системы
Выбор вида связан от корпоративной компании. Открытые стимулируют развитие среды, приватные оптимизируют собственные процессы.
Значение API в разработке платформ цифровых продуктов
Среда компьютерных решений представляет собой структуру взаимосвязанных решений, усиливающих функциональность друг друга. Программные интерфейсы представляют связующим компонентом между модулями. Технология позволяет самостоятельным сервисам выполняться как цельное образование.
Крупные технологические предприятия создают инфраструктуры вокруг основных продуктов. Программисты создают приложения, расширяющие инструменты ключевого решения через Покердом официальный сайт выданных инструментов. Клиенты обретают доступ к тысячам вспомогательных возможностей без изменения платформы.
Совместные внедрения наращивают важность продуктов для клиентов. Система заказа гостиниц интегрируется с авиакомпаниями и платформами расчётов. Юзер организует поездку в общем инструменте благодаря коммуникации массы сервисов.
Общедоступные средства стимулируют новшества и привлекают инженеров к созданию сервисов. Организация специализируется на ключевой функциональности, а партнёры привносят профильные инструменты. Модель убыстряет рост системы и наращивает приверженность клиентов.
Воздействие API на оперативность разработки новых функций
Темп запуска системы на рынок формирует успешность предприятия в цифровой экономике. Софтверные интерфейсы сокращают период создания за помощь готовых инструментов. Коллектив сосредотачивается на уникальной опциях вместо построения основных модулей.
Подключение сторонних систем сберегает месяцы труда инженеров. Подключение платформы расчётов или позиционирования требует сутки вместо недель собственной разработки. Программный инструмент через Pokerdom даёт проверенную функциональность, подготовленную к использованию.
Компонентная архитектура обеспечивает специалистам работать синхронно над отличающимися компонентами продукта. Разработчики строят независимые компоненты с индивидуальными инструментами. Части интегрируются в завершённый сервис без конфликтов.
Повторное эксплуатация логики убыстряет создание обновлённых релизов приложений. Компания формирует внутренние средства для стандартных задач: идентификации, уведомлений, сохранения сведений. Новые задачи используют готовые модули. Подход сокращает количество ошибок и ускоряет поддержку.



